Billikens Fall to ISU, 2-1

Aug. 31, 2004

Final Stats

NORMAL, Ill. - Saint Louis University women's soccer dropped a 2-1 decision at Illinois State this afternoon as the Redbirds scored on a pair of corners. The Billikens out-shot ISU 19-8 and forced keeper Andrea Shaw into six saves, but could not put home the tying goal despite dominating possession through much of the game. SLU tied the game in the 63rd minute. Dee Guempel sent Jamie Perry long up the left side where she dribbled around a set of defenders to feed Maureen Hughes on the right side. Hughes played the ball toward the end line then came back toward the top of the box looking for an opening to bury her shot into the left side netting. The Redbirds took the lead on just their second shot of the half. Michelle Brumbaugh served a corner to the left side where SLU goalkeeper Amanda Martin came out to punch the ball clear. Joyce Kleinheinz was able to collect the rebound and send a shot toward the goal where it deflected off a defender and past Martin in the 73rd minute. The Billikens again took over the momentum as they looked for the tying strike. Guempel's shot was tipped just over the cross bar, and Kelly Ferguson shot at the near post required a team save as ISU goalkeeper Andrea Shaw was caught out of position. Despite the Billikens dominating play early in the first half, the Redbirds got on the board first in the 26th minute. Michelle Brumbaugh served a corner from the right side to the left corner of the box where Heather Forsyth headed it into the upper right corner of the goal. The Billikens' best opportunity to knot the score before the half came in the waning moments of the period. Ferguson sent a long ball from the midfield to the goal box where MaKensie Johnson was charging at the ISU keeper. As the ball continued its arc, Shaw was able to corral it just before Johnson. The Billikens continue their four-game road stretch at the Kansas Invitational, facing Mississippi State on Fri., Sept. 3, at 2:30 p.m.
